2012-02-15 14 views
0

我正在通过CSS媒体查询为客户端网站构建一个响应式主题。它以纵向模式在iPhone和Android上显示移动网站,但在Android上,常规网站以横向模式显示(iPhone显示横向移动网站)。什么是适当的CSS媒体查询让Android手机在横向模式下使用移动格式?

下面是媒体查询我用我的薄CSS文件:

all and (max-width: 480px), (max-device-width: 480px), screen and (-webkit-min-device-pixel-ratio: 2) 

是否有可能对大多数Android手机,我可以适应不同的宽度是多少?

回答

1

像素尺寸没有可以被认为是面向未来的标准。

尝试使用物理宽度(例如15厘米),而不是以像素为单位的大小,这些大小在设备间会有很大差异。

1

大多数新的Android手机在横向模式下的宽度可能超过800像素(这是更多的平板电脑肖像)。您可能想要添加的内容虽然也是最大高度,但可以检测到500px左右的“移动风景”,并调整一些您可能需要与完整模式不同的内容。